Did water activities in Malvan, 28 March 2024




Today was our last day in Malvan, so we decided to indulge in water sports. We headed to Chivla Beach in the morning around 7:15 after pre-booking the activities the previous night. Although it was past 7, the sun had yet to appear. We boarded the boat and were taken to see dolphins, spotting only a few. Later, we visited a very small island covered in shells and collected some as souvenirs.Our guides shared stories about other small islands we saw, which are now just broken stones.

By 9 am, we returned to the hotel, had breakfast, and changed into our swimwear for the water activities.



Back at Chivla Beach, we experienced scuba diving for the first time. The water was clean and calm, providing an enjoyable experience. However, we couldn't dive together as it wasn't allowed. We were provided video clips of our diving experience, featuring small, cute fishes. Next, we tried parasailing, with me opting for a deeper experience while bubbles kept it simple due to fear(Jk). Some people on the boat vomited due to the motion. Following that, we tried jet skiing, which ended quickly as we were only passengers, not riders. Then came the banana ride, where we were tossed into the water twice, but swimming wasn't an issue for us. Lastly, we tried another activity, the name of which I can't recall, but it was also enjoyable. After a day full of fun, I caught a cold, so we returned to the hotel around 5 or 6 pm, took a bath, and had dinner and fell asleep.

overnight oats- how i make my overnight oats

How I Make My Overnight Oats RECIPE Ingredients: • Oats - 5 tbsp • Chia seeds - 2 tbsp • Honey - 1 tbsp • Milk or water - enough to soak • Yogurt - 3 tbsp • Nuts and seeds - 2 tsp • Banana - 1 Method: 1. First, add the oats and chia seeds to a bowl, then pour in milk or water. Mix well to combine. 2.Add the yogurt on top and stir to combine again. 3.Next, add 2 chopped dates, 4 almonds, and seeds like pumpkin, flax, and sunflower. Sometimes, I also add dried cranberries and raisins. 4.Drizzle honey on top, give it a final mix, and refrigerate for at least 8-10 hours. 5.In the morning, add some chopped banana or other fruits or berries, and enjoy it for breakfast.
